Commit 2462ca67 authored by Nathan Haug's avatar Nathan Haug
Browse files

Allowing sequential slash characters in the url validation to allow second...

Allowing sequential slash characters in the url validation to allow second http:// to be used. Issue #128502.
parent 7d151ffc
...@@ -394,9 +394,7 @@ function link_validate_url($text) { ...@@ -394,9 +394,7 @@ function link_validate_url($text) {
$internal_pattern = "/^([a-z0-9_\-+]+)"; $internal_pattern = "/^([a-z0-9_\-+]+)";
// the rest of the path // the rest of the path
$end = "(\/[a-z0-9_\-\.~+%=&,$'():;*@]+)*". $end = "(\/[a-z0-9_\-\.~+%=&,$'():;*@]*)*".
// forward slash 0 or 1 times
'(\/)?'.
// query string // query string
"(\/?\?[a-z0-9+_\-\.\/%=&,$'():;*@]*)?". "(\/?\?[a-z0-9+_\-\.\/%=&,$'():;*@]*)?".
// anchors // anchors
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ment